Gel Afshan Mud Volcano in Chabahar is one of the fascinating and rare phenomena of nature that flow the mud from underground and explode it to the surface of the earth and ultimately take the shape of a hill. You can see the highest number of gel-feshan in Sistan and Baluchestan province. Nearly 20 gel-feshan have been identified in this province, which you can see them at Jask, Minab, Chabahar and Guader Gulf. Gel-feshan, is not only recognized as a geological phenomenon but also an important factor for tourism and hospitality. Gel-feshan in Chabahar often occurs in coastal areas and are considered as a spectacular view of the city. Seeing the Chabahar Glaciers for anyone who travels to this region is truly wonderful. The Chabahar's Gel-feshan has been operating in all seasons, but the most activit time is in summer, which is a season of rainfalls in southeastern Iran. The content of Chabahar Gel-feshan is from turbine, petroleum mud, sulfur and etc. which has organic compounds and has various therapeutic uses. Chabahar's Gel-feshan's mud is used to treat diseases such as articular and spinal pains, neurological diseases, muscle contractions, gynecological diseases, and so on.
